Tech Thursday With PC Mag

Victor Yap from PC Mag SEA highlights the biggest tech news of the month and also reviews the Dell XPS 13 2017 edition in #GadgetInFocus (GIF Review).

 

0:27 - Sony Launches Sony 4K OLED

2:13 - Microsoft EDU Goes Official: The Simplified Windows That Is Designed For Education

6:22 - Samsung Launches Samsung Galaxy S8

9:44 - Microsoft Build Highlights (Build 2017)

9:57 - Build 2017: Microsoft Partners With HP and Intel To Develop More Cortana Devices

10:32 - Build 2017: Microsoft Unveils Windows 10 Fall Creators Update

12:02 - Build 2017: Windows Mixed Reality Motion Controller Goes Official

13:17 - Build 2017: Acer Windows Mixed Reality Headset

14:20 - Wannacry Ransomware Accidental Hero

18:15 - Sony Square Project in Tokyo

23:41 - Acer Predator 21 X Gaming Notebook Priced At RM40,000!

26:26 - Google I/O Conference 2017

31:15 - Sony CEO, Kaz Hirai Turned Around Sony In 5 Years And Sees Highest Profit Since 1998 

34:42 - GIF Of The Month: Dell XPS 13 (2017 Edition)
